I love it. It is very comfortable to sit on for hours while doing emails online and playing games online. I decided to put it together myself I think this was a mistake. It is difficult to get the back on the chair. The rest of it was easy the castors were very easy to put on. and the arms. However we had to take the arms off and put them on the back of the chair first then try and line up the back with the seat. It took hours for us to do. Also one thing when they designed the chair. They covered the screw holes with the vinyl and the screws wouldn't screw because the vinl was in the way. Other than that when you get it together it is a very nice chair. If i bought another one. I think I would spend the extra money to have them put it together and deliver it to me already assembled. A lot less stress.
